Iceland) report on behalf of a large collaboration:\n\nWe observed the field of the short GRB 140903A (Cummings et al., GCN\n16763) using the 2.5m Nordic Optical Telescope (NOT) equipped with\nStanCam and NOTCam. We observed for a total of 20 and 30 min in the R-\nand H- bands, respectively. The middle times of the observations are\n29.898 hr and 30.315 hr after the BAT trigger, respectively.\n\nThe previously reported object (Capone et al., GCN 16769; Cenko  et\nal., GCN 16770;  Fruchter, GCN 16776; Dichiara et al., GCN 16781) is\nclearly detected in our R- and H-band stacked images. We found\nR=20.1+/-0.5 mag calibrated with nearby SDSS stars and H=16.1+/-0.3\nmag calibrated with the nearby 2MASS stars.\n\nNote that a fuzzy source is present at the same position in the SDSS\nfield, especially in z-band. Together with the pre- and post-burst\nobservations, the optical brightness of the object either varies\nslowly or remains constant (see also Fruchter, GCN 16776), which\nimplies that what we're observing in optical is basically the host\ngalaxy of the burst.\n\n[GCN OPS NOTE(05sep14): Per author's request, the affilliation of SG\nwas changed to ESO.]",
